Hotel Wild Olive 11 - Windhoek Namibia - Photos
No photos
Hotel Wild Olive 11 - Windhoek Namibia - Search and Book Hotel
Ombika Street Kleine Kuppe,
9000 Windhoek
Hotels 3 Stars Namibia
No photos
Ombika Street Kleine Kuppe,
9000 Windhoek
Hotels 3 Stars Namibia